Selenium Sulfide Shampoo
Dandruff patients may be able to find relief with selenium sulfide shampoos. This is an antifungal compound that may stop fungus from growing on the scalp. Sometimes, individuals can use formulas that they purchase over-the-counter. However, these may not always be strong enough. In a case like this, patients may need a dermatologist to prescribe stronger shampoo. However, individuals may not be able to use these shampoos every day. They do appear to be too strong for this. Instead, once or twice a week might be what is recommended. In addition, pregnant women may not be able to use these shampoos safely. They will likely need to discuss their options with their doctor first.
Individuals may need to shake the bottle before using this shampoo. This should help the shampoo mix well. They will also need to rinse their hair a few times. They may not be able to get all of the shampoo out at first. Making sure that it is all gone is essential. Heat and moisture also do not appear to be nice for this shampoo. So, individuals may want to consider storing it at room temperature. Patients should also note that they may experience side effects. Possibilities seem to include skin peeling, redness, itching, and blistering on their scalp. These side effects may need patients to stop using the shampoo. If they occur, they should contact their doctor.
